Consolidated Liberator B.VIII

Aircraft & Exhibits, JAN 1944-JUL 1974, London, Hangar Five, 74/A/790

Although often overshadowed by the B-17 Flying Fortress, the American B-24 Liberator was built in greater numbers than any other US military aircraft and served with distinction in both war and peace. It also played a major role in service with the RAF.

Recorded interview with Flight Lieutenant James Grant Meiklejohn, 28 April 1996

Film & Sound, In Storage, X008-3344

James Meiklejohn trained as a pilot in Spitfires, Mustangs and gliders during the Second World War. He explains how, due to the end of the war, he didn’t fly operationally.
